Year 20 was a leap year starting on Monday (link will display the full calendar) of the Julian calendar.
Events[]
By place[]
Roman Empire[]
- Galba is a Roman praetor.
- Marcus Valerius Messalla Barbatus becomes a consul.
Asia[]
- First year of Dihuang era of the Chinese Xin Dynasty.
By Topic[]
Arts and Sciences[]
- Philo defines philosophy as the maidservant of theology.
Births[]
Deaths[]
- Hillel the Elder, Talmudic scholar, his school and teachings were the most influential in the Talmud.
- Vipsania Agrippina, wife of Gaius Asinius Gallus and former wife of Tiberius. (b. 36 BC)
